Types of Safe Racing Seat

Safe racing seats come in various types, each designed to cater to specific preferences and needs. Some of these types include:

  • Bucket Seats

    Bucket seats are molded to the shape of the occupant's body. They offer a snug fit that helps to minimize movement and maximize support. The snug fit of bucket seats ensures that drivers and passengers maintain their positions during high-speed maneuvers, enabling them to focus on the race rather than adjusting their seating positions.

  • Bench Seats

    Bench seats are designed to accommodate multiple occupants. They provide a wider seating area, which is ideal for team racing or events where multiple crew members may need to be present. While bench seats prioritize space and teamwork, they may not offer the same level of individual support as bucket seats. However, manufacturers have integrated additional safety features into racing bench seats to ensure occupant safety during competitive events.

  • High-Back Seats

    High-back seats extend to support the occupant's head and neck. These seats reduce the chances of whiplash and other injuries by offering additional head and neck support. High-back seats are particularly beneficial in fast-paced racing environments where sudden accelerations and decelerations occur.

  • HANS-Compatible Seats

    Some racing seats are designed to be used with the Head and Neck Support (HANS) device. These seats come with specific mounting points and contours to securely connect to the HANS device, offering even more protection by preventing head and neck movement during crashes.

  • Child Racing Seats

    Child racing seats are designed for young occupants. These seats ensure that children are safely secured and positioned correctly within the vehicle during racing activities. Child racing seats comply with safety standards and regulations while offering comfort and support for young passengers.

  • Adjustable Racing Seats

    Adjustable racing seats allow for customization of seating positions to accommodate occupants of different sizes. The adjustability feature enhances comfort and support while ensuring that all occupants maintain their positions during racing activities.

Specifications and maintenance of safe racing seats

A number of factors need to be considered when choosing a racing seat for any motorsport application. Here are the specifications of a safe racing seat.

  • Seat construction

    The safest seats in racing are constructed using lightweight materials such as carbon fiber or fiberglass. These materials are durable and strong, providing maximum protection for the driver by withstanding the impact of a crash. The seats are also constructed using aluminum or steel which provides additional safety.

  • Seat size

    The racing car seats are made in different sizes to accommodate different body sizes. The seats are designed to provide a snug fit to the driver. A well-fit seat prevents the driver from moving around during the race, which improves their focus and ability to control the car.

  • Seat padding

    The seats have padded headrests, shoulder areas, and cushions to provide comfort to the driver. The padding also provides safety by absorbing impact during a collision.

  • Seat harness

    Safe racing seats come with seat harnesses that are integrated into the seat. The harness has adjustable straps that are secured to the seat. The harness keeps the driver securely in place during the race. It also has a buckle that can easily be opened or closed.

    The racing seats also have a five-point or six-point harness seat belt that secures the driver to the seat. The seat belt is designed with high-quality materials to provide maximum safety. The seat belts have low stretch webbing, and the buckle and clip are made of high-strength aluminum or steel.

  • Seat back angle

    Safe racing seats are designed with a back seat angle of 10 to 30 degrees. This angle helps to keep the driver in a stable position during the race. The angle of a racing seat is also adjustable, allowing drivers to customize it according to their comfort preferences.

  • Seat mounting

    The seats are designed with mounting holes that make it easy to install the seats in the vehicle. The holes are compatible with different seat mounting styles.

Below are some of the maintenance requirements of safe racing seats.

  • Regular inspection

    It is important to regularly inspect racing seats for any signs of wear and damage. The inspection should be done before and after every race. Any damaged seats should be replaced immediately to maintain the safety of drivers.

  • Seat harness

    The seat harness should be inspected regularly for any signs of wear or damage. The straps of the seat harness should remain untwisted and should be checked to ensure they remain taut. In case the fabric of the seat harness is worn out, it should be replaced immediately.

  • Cleaning

    Safe racing seats should be cleaned after every race. The seats should be cleaned using a soft brush and a mild detergent. Avoid using harsh chemicals when cleaning the seats as they can cause damage.

How to choose safe racing seats

There are several factors that buyers need to consider when choosing a safe racing seat. They include the following:

Firstly, buyers need to consider the safe racing seat size. The seats are available in different sizes, from small to extra-large. It is important to choose a seat that will fit a driver well. The largest seat in a vehicle won’t be useful if the driver cannot fit into it properly. When choosing a seat, consider the height and weight of the driver. A large and oversized seat may not be suitable for younger drivers or those with a small stature.

Another important factor to consider is the safe racing seat’s design. As mentioned earlier, seats are designed differently to accommodate different body shapes and sizes. Opt for seats with a backrest that can be adjusted. The seats should have additional padding and cushions to make them more comfortable.

Consider the materials used to make a safe racing seat. The seats are made from different materials, including leather and fabric. Each material has its own advantages. Leather seats are great because they are durable and easy to clean. Fabric seats offer good value for money, and they are available in a range of colors.

The budget will also determine the type of safe racing seats purchased. The seats come in different prices, so buyers should shop around and look for what fits their budget. It is important to note that the most affordable seats may not have all the desirable features. Buyers should also consider the features included in the seats when working within a budget.

Lastly, buyers should consider the style of a safe racing seat. Seats are designed in different styles to match various preferences. Select a seat with a design that will match the interior of the vehicle. If planning to sell the vehicle in the future, choose a seat that is popular and can offer good resale value.

How to DIY and Replace Safe Racing Seats

Safe racing seat replacement is a simple process. Seats that are bolted to the floor are the easiest to work on. Once the old seat is removed, the process of installing a racing seat begins. Follow the steps for a DIY safe racing seat replacement.

  • Preparation

    Park the car in a safe and clean environment. Gather all the tools that will be used in the process. These include a socket set, ratchet, screwdriver, bolts, and seatbelts. New seats and seat mounts should also be in the workspace. Work on one seat at a time.

  • Removal of the old seat

    Start loosening the bolts that hold the seat to the floor. This might be difficult because the bolts are often rusty. Using a penetrating lubricant can make the process easier. Once the bolts are loose, use a ratchet or a screwdriver to remove them completely. The seat is now free. Next, disconnect the seatbelelts. They are usually connected to the floor with a few bolts. Remove the seatbelts before taking out the seat. Lift the seat out of the car. This is easy if the seat is light. However, it can be a two-person job if the seat is heavy.

  • Installing the new seat

    Start by installing the seat mounts. They are bolted to the floor and hold the seat in place. The mounts make the seat stable and safe. Slide the new seat onto the mounts. Then, bolt the seat to the mounts. Make sure the racing seat is secure by tightening the bolts. Connect the seatbelts to the mounts. They should be connected to the floor with bolts. The seatbelts prevent the driver and passengers from moving around in the seat during a crash.

  • Adjustments

    Adjust the seat to make sure it is comfortable. The seat position should allow the driver to have a clear view of the road. The pedals should also be reachable. The headrest should be adjusted to fit the height of the driver. It should be close to the back of the head.

  • Testing

    Before hitting the track or road, make sure to test the new seat. Buckle the seatbelts and sit in the seat to make sure it is comfortable. Move around to see if it is secure. The racing seat should hold the body in place without moving around. Go through all the controls in the car to make sure they are accessible. Take the car for a test drive. This helps to check that the seat position is right and comfortable.

Q and A

Q1: Are carbon racing seats safe?

A1: Carbon racing seats are safe. They are designed to be high in strength and low in weight to support the driver, especially during crashes. The safe racing seat also has side wings to support the head and torso. They hold the driver in place during the race.

Q2: What is a racing seat?

A2: A racing seat is a seat designed to provide safety and comfort to the user. The seats are designed to hold the driver or passenger in place, especially during fast and sharp turns.

Q3: Are high back seats better?

A3: High back seats are better because they provide more support to the back of the head and neck. This is important when driving at high speeds, as it reduces the risk of injury.
